]]>Do I need a 100 amp or 200 amp electrical panel?
The answer depends on your home’s size, electrical usage, and future plans.
In many Long Island homes, especially older ones, 100 amp panels were once standard. However, modern electrical demand has changed significantly, and many homeowners are now upgrading to 200 amp service.
Understanding the difference helps you make the right decision for safety, performance, and long-term value.
Amperage refers to the amount of electrical current your panel can safely handle at one time.
Think of it like capacity.
If your home tries to use more electricity than your panel can support, breakers trip to prevent overheating or damage.

]]>How much does it cost to upgrade an electrical panel?
The answer depends on several factors, including your current system, the size of the upgrade, and the electrical demands of your home.
In Long Island, where many homes were built decades ago, panel upgrades are one of the most common electrical improvements homeowners invest in.
Whether you’re installing an EV charger, upgrading your HVAC system, or dealing with frequent breaker trips, understanding the cost can help you plan the right solution.
Here’s a general breakdown of what homeowners can expect in Long Island.
Electrical Panel Upgrade Cost Breakdown| Type of Upgrade | Typical Cost Range | What It Includes |
|---|---|---|
| Standard 200-amp Upgrade | $1,500 – $7,500 | Panel replacement, new breakers, improved capacity |
| Full-Service Replacement / Heavy Capacity | $7,500 – $15,000+ | Service line upgrades, meter work, high-demand systems |
These ranges vary depending on your home and electrical setup, but they give a realistic starting point.

Most 200 amp panel upgrades in Long Island range from $1,500 to $7,500 depending on the home and electrical setup.
Costs increase when additional work is required such as service line upgrades, meter relocation, wiring updates, or code compliance improvements.
Yes. Panel upgrades improve safety, increase electrical capacity, and allow your home to support modern appliances and systems.
Most electrical panel upgrades are completed in one day, although more complex projects may take longer depending on the scope.
Yes. Most panel upgrades require permits and inspections to ensure the work meets local electrical codes.
